#633bc4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#633bc4 is composed of 38.8% red, 23.1%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 49.5% cyan, 69.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 23.1% black. It has a hue angle of 257.5 degrees, a saturation of 53.7% and a lightness of 50%. #633bc4 color hex could be obtained by blending #c676ff with #000089. Closest websafe color is: #6633cc.

#633bc4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#633bc4 has RGB values of R:99, G:59, B:196 and CMYK values of C:0.49, M:0.7, Y:0,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 6503364.

Shades and Tints of #633bc4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#08050f is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#633bc4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7b7689 is the less saturated color, while #4b00ff is the most saturated one.
